Hi, I am seeing these problems as well and also started with the M5 version of AF 2.0. When I commented out the gzip filter I get the page at http://localhost:8080/services/ but it only lists the UserService and has the problem with the double slash in the URL. Where is the file in which the URL can be fixed? Also, I've marked up 3 more services plus the Person service from the tutorial and am still not seeing any of those 4 services those show up. I looked at xfire-servlet.xml and there are 4 copies of the file, all in the target directory (where is the source for this file?) and none of them list any of the services, even the UserService that shows up in the above listing. It doesn't look like the annotations are being turned into entries in xfire-servlet.xml, is there more info on this? Also, should I upgrade to the official 2.0 release since I started this project on 2.0M5?
